Definition of coastal area
Coastal Area is the area located within a distance of 100 km from the coastline for EOA and 50 km for WOA & SOA. Whereas the area beyond these limits is Inland Area. reference. PAGE 9 OF 23, 01 TMSS 01 R 03 clause 4.5.1.
Zinc Coating & hot-dip galvanization of Structures
below is the Zinc coating thickness for structures. Each area have a different requirement of zinc coating thickness
i. 130 microns, equivalent to 915 g/m2 for all structures in the coastal area
ii. 86 microns, equivalent to 610 g/m2 for all structures in the inland area
iii. All structures that lie within 25 km radial distance from the coastline in SEC-WOA and SEC-SOA network shall have protection with a duplex system (galvanizing + painting). The minimum zinc coating thickness in this case shall be 86μm before painting.
Crossing of major highways/expressways
Design engineer shall use Assembly type Single Conductor Double Tension Assembly (SCDT) For crossing of major highways/expressways when using anchor structures on 69kV to 230kV single conductor per phase transmission lines. Reference TCS-P-122.21 R1 clause 2.7 and TES P 122 04 R 03
Crossing of Transmission lines
A design/construction engineer shall use Assembly types Single Conductor Double Suspension Assembly (SCDS) and Twin Bundle Conductor Double Suspension Assembly CDS (2) on 69kV to 230kV transmission lines for overhead crossing with other transmission lines of the same or lower voltage. Reference TCS-P-122.21 R1 clause 2.7 & TES P 122 04 R 03
Transposition of Transmission Lines
All 230 kV and 380 kV transmission lines greater than 90 km in length shall need transposition at intervals along the line at points having distance as below.
Whereas, transmission lines less than 90 km in length and/or lines with delta conductor configuration may not require transposition except in extreme cases of very high load flow or very long distances (≈ 300 km & above).
i. For 90-270 km long transmission line, Single/Double Circuit Vertical Conductor Configuration one complete roll of transposition (one transposition barrel)- (two transposition structures or three sections of equal length, eachbeing L/3).
ii. For transmission line longer than 270 km, two complete rolls of transposition (two transposition barrels) (five transposition structures or six sections of equal length, each being L/6).

Conductor and OPGW Greasing requirement
All conductors to be used in the Red Sea Coastal Regions of Western Operating Area (WOA) and Southern Operating Area (SOA) shall be greased as per IEC 61394 and Annexure C (figure C.5) of IEC 61089. Conductors shall also be greased if specifically ordered in the SOW/TS.
